Overview

This factory 2002 Audi A3 Service and Repair Manual provides comprehensive technical specifications, diagnostic procedures, troubleshooting information, and step-by-step repair instructions for the first-generation Audi A3 (8L).

The manual covers all factory-equipped petrol and diesel engines, manual and automatic transmissions, quattro all-wheel drive systems (where equipped), engine management, suspension, steering, braking systems, electrical systems, climate control, body repairs, and complete factory wiring diagrams.

It also includes scheduled maintenance procedures, torque specifications, diagnostic routines, service intervals, and manufacturer-approved repair methods.
